girls_ravenswood.jpgFor more than 25 years, the "I Have A Dream" Foundation - New York Metro Area has been sponsoring entire grade levels of students in under-resourced public schools and housing developments, and working with these "Dreamers" from early elementary school all the way through to college. Chelsea Dreamer + Mentor Win Nike's "More Than A Game" Mentor Contest

Job Bridges and Eloisa Ananias

Chelsea II Mentor Eloisa Ananias was awared the More Than a Game Mentor Award by Nike. Ananias, who commits to mentoring Job two times a month throughout the year, will receive a Nike finisher jacket. In addition, NIKE will donate 100 tee shirts and other promotional items to the Chelsea-Elliott Dreamers.

More Than a Game is the story of five talented young basketball players from Akron, Ohio star in this remarkable true-life coming of age story about uncommon friendship in the face all too common adversities. Coached by a charismatic but inexperienced player's father, and led by future NBA superstar LeBron James, the "Fab Five's" improbable seven-year journey leads them from a decrepit inner-city gym to the doorstep of a national high school championship. Along the way, the close-knit team is repeatedly tested--both on and off the court--as James' exploding worldwide celebrity threatens to destroy everything they've set out to achieve together.

IHDF-NY to Participate in Lights on Afterschool Event

On Thursday, October 22, the "I Have A Dream" Foundation - New York Metro Area  will participate in the Afterschool Alliance’s tenth annual Lights On Afterschool celebration, which recognizes the importance of afterschool programs across the country. This event will take place in more than 7,500 communities and involve more than 1 million people.  Please contact Hilary Cramer at 212-293-5480 x11 for more details or to RSVP. DeHostos-Wise Dreamers Featured by Free Arts NYC!

Free Arts NYC programs "inspire children to re-imagine their worlds and transform their lives through the creative arts. With the help of dedicated and caring volunteer mentors, Free Arts NYC delivers creative arts programs directly to low income, homeless, abused and neglected children." The DeHostos-Wise Dreamers have been working with Free Arts for four years, and love participating in all of the projects that they offer. In this video, the Dreamers talk about their backgrounds, their experience with Free Arts, and why it enriches their lives.
